What is a matboard?

What are matboards? To put it simply, mat boards are a thin piece of card or paper-based material that rests underneath your picture when framed. This can often be seen as a simple border separating your artwork from the inner border of your frame.

What is a picture frame called?

Moulding (Frame) The more technical term for the frame is moulding, which refers to to just to the material the frame is made of. Most moulding is made of either wood, metal or plastic and comes in thousands of different designs.

What to use to keep pictures from moving?

Use Two Hooks, Not One In order to keep picture frames from moving on the walls, use two nails or hooks to which you attach the hanging wire; if you’re using a sawtooth hanger, opt to use two instead of one to ensure that the frame is straight.

How can I hang a picture without a hook?

Lay your picture face down on a flat surface. Press small balls of reusable adhesive or small squares of double-sided tape to the corners of your picture (on the back of the picture). If you’re hanging a larger picture, frame the back outside edge with adhesive or tape. Mount your picture.

What is a Passepartout frame?

A passepartout is a cardboard cut out in the middle and placed in your picture frame between the picture and the glass. The passepartout is available in different shapes and colours, which gives you a lot of creative freedom and your creativity is not limited.

What can I use instead of a mat board?

Use alternative forms of matboard: Scrapbooking papers (a wide selection can be found at any craft store), recycled, vintage papers (see above!), or even swatches of thick fabric can all be used to mat art and photography.

What is a floating frame?

What is a float frame? A float frame, as the name implies, is designed in such a way that the artwork appears to float within the frame; it is not pressed behind a piece of glass. Because of this illusion, viewers of your artwork gain a sense of three-dimensional depth when viewing the piece.
